DETROIT (3/8/2021) -- The University of Detroit Mercy Department of Athletics has made some changes to its outdoor fan policy. Starting today, March 8, any home match or game played
ON campus will have a select number of Titan fans to cheer on the red, white and blue.
As part of the new policy, each member of the Titan team will be allowed to have two members on its "guest list". The fans are confined to the home team only and not for visiting teams/outside fans.
"We have always recognized the importance of fans, especially family, to attend games," said Director of Athletics
Robert C. Vowels, Jr. "All of the policies we have implemented were always for the safety and well-being of our student-athletes, staff and fans. After discussing the matter further within our athletic staff, we have devised a plan that will allow family and friends to attend and if followed, will keep everyone safe as we continue to deal with the pandemic."
The Department of Athletics is also asking all families to review the fan policies of all games when the team is on the road. Each institution and conference has its own set of rules. The policy below is just for Titan home games on campus.
Below is the Titan fan policy that must be followed by everyone:
- Each student-athlete will be allowed to have a maximum of two (2) guests in attendance at all home games.

- Bleacher seating will be unavailable, standing room only around Titan Field and in the hills in the outfield at Buysse Ballpark.
- Masks must be worn at all times; social distancing must be maintained between families from different households.
- Calihan Hall will be unavailable for fans to utilize restrooms.
- No tailgating will be allowed on the campus of Detroit Mercy.
- Proper distance must be maintained between parents and their student-athletes at all times.
- Please do not arrive more than 45 minutes before the start of the contest.
- When the game is over, fans must vacate the area and not congregate in the parking lots. This is due to the student-athletes and coaches are currently engaged in testing requirements for participation and to not jeopardize the season for the rest of the team.
